Just because it says its from, say 'Memnoch' or even ME, and it has a virus attached, it doesn't mean these people sent it, or are even FROM them!
Here is why: Some one named Jim is infected with a Mass mailer virus. reads the forum a lot, all the while, this virus from HIS PC, is pulling random names and random email addresses (only if you post it, IW email address are safe). Then, the virus shoots out emails with random taken names, email addresses (and SOME even put the from address as the one PULLED from a website). The World needs to pass a Law, making email addresses as important as a visa or State Drivers ID. And 100% tracable. This will stop SPAM, VIRUII, and maybe even catch sicko's. I've actually seen in MY EMAIL, a message from 'Ironworks' with a virus attached, and it had a baldurs gate item image (a sword jpg) attached!!!! So, don't just watch out for Mem's emails or Javi's. Watch out for ALL emails, coming from even your best friend or FAMILY! [img]smile.gif[/img] Keep a good virus scanner up to date, and never (N E V E R) run an EXE, COM, BAT, VBS, SCR or anything else as an attachment. NEVER. Always go with the assumption that any attachment is a virus. This type of behavior has kept me from being hit over the last 11 years except 2 times. once, a simple virus called 'Junkie.boot' which messed up a command.com file in DOS 5.5, and the other was that first huge virus that would attack website IISS servers and was Microsofts fault for having the opening. [img]smile.gif[/img] Remember this: ANY Email you get from Ironworks Gaming, Ironworks Forum, The Great Escape, Ziroc, Dan Huling will always contain text only. If I am sending you an attachment, you would know about it first in a previous email--but even THEN, scan it anyway! [img]smile.gif[/img] If you can set 'options' on incoming emails, make a setting that ALL attachments that come into your INBOX to be highlighted as RED. or BOLD and RED. This will tell you right away 99% of the time that those are probably virus emails. Hope you read all that [img]smile.gif[/img] The more people that do, the more members PC's will be saved.

Never download anything from an e-mail unless the person who has sent it makes a very clear note of what it is. Calaethis sent me a 200k e-mail, but he actually wrote in his e-mail that it was a bunch of pictures. Also check virus names. If they're something like "friends.scr" or "love.scr" they're viruses.
